MSU Beats UConn in Dramatic Fashion, 5-4

After losing late to Memphis on Wednesday, the Diamond Dawgs won late on Friday. State beat Conneticut 5-4 after being down 4-0.

Ben Bracewell started the game for MSU and went three scoreless innings before he left with soreness after 42 pitches. Chris Stratton came in and was greeted rudely as UConn hit a 3-run homer in the 4th inning. From there Stratton settled down and pitched the rest of the game. He improved his record to 3-0.

The Bulldogs got a run on the board in the 7th, and then made it 4-3 on a Trey Porter 2-run homer in the 8th. In the 9th, a single, error by UConn on a sacrifice bunt and another error on a grounder to 3rd led to the tying and winning run for State.

MSU improved to 7-2 on the year.
